Texas Instruments TM4C1290NCPDTI3R: 32-bit Microcontroller Comprehensive Overview
The Texas Instruments TM4C1290NCPDTI3R is a high-performance 32-bit microcontroller based on the ARM® Cortex®-M4F core. It operates at a maximum frequency of 120 MHz, delivering 150 DMIPS performance. The device features 1 MB of flash memory, 256 KB of single-cycle system SRAM, and 6 KB of EEPROM. Housed in a 128-pin TQFP package, it supports an extended operating temperature range of -40°C to 105°C. This microcontroller is part of the Tiva™ C Series, designed for applications requiring advanced connectivity, real-time control, and high performance.
TM4C1290NCPDTI3R Features
The TM4C1290NCPDTI3R offers a wide range of integrated features to support complex applications. It includes two 12-bit ADC modules with a maximum sample rate of one million samples per second, three independent analog comparators, and 16 digital comparators. The microcontroller also supports multiple communication interfaces, such as eight UARTs, four QSSI modules, ten I2C modules, two CAN 2.0 controllers, and USB 2.0 OTG/host/device with Link Power Management (LPM) support. Additionally, it features an 8-/16-/32-bit External Peripheral Interface (EPI) for peripherals and memory, a low-power hibernation module, and a 32-channel µDMA controller. These capabilities make it suitable for applications requiring extensive connectivity and real-time processing.
TM4C1290NCPDTI3R Applications
The TM4C1290NCPDTI3R is ideal for applications that demand high connectivity and real-time control. It is commonly used in human-machine interface (HMI) systems, networked system management controllers, and industrial automation. The microcontroller's robust communication interfaces and high performance make it suitable for applications such as smart meters, medical devices, and automotive control systems. Its ability to support advanced motion control through PWM and quadrature encoder interface (QEI) modules also makes it a strong candidate for motor control applications.
